Civil No Contact Order

A Civil No Contact Order is requested in civil court and is specifically for victims of sexual assault who want the court to order the perpetrator to stay away from the victim.

It is not necessary to report this crime to police in order to request a Civil No Contact Order, and an attorney is not required. The paperwork is filled out at the Circuit Court Clerk’s Office. Assistance in filling out the paperwork is available from Stepping Stones YWCA Sexual Assault Services, by telephoning PATH at (309) 827-4005, or through the Illinois State University’s Sexual Assault Prevention and Survivor Services Program at (309) 438-2778 or (309) 438-7948. When an order is issued by the court, students are encouraged to provide a copy of the order to the Vice President of Student Affairs, located in Hovey Hall (309) 438-5451) and the Illinois State University Police (309) 438-8631), as well as maintaining a copy of the order in their possession at all times.
